Xper computed tomography‐guided translumbar inferior vena cava catheterization for long‐term hemodialysis: A case report and literature review

Abstract: Hemodialysis is the most widely used renal replacement therapy for end-stage renal disease patients. Exhausted vascular access due to repeated indwelling central venous catheters is becoming a challenging clinical problem, which also contributes to reduced survival of the hemodialysis patients. Lack of conventional peripheral and central venous access mandates the use of alternative strategies.
